Released April 2, 2021. Music by Ben Babbitt, spanning work from 2011 to 2020. Comprises music from the game's interludes, radio music, videos, cutouts, extended drifting mixes, and others. Mastered by Theo Karon at Hotel Earth in Los Angeles, CA.

Released May 6, 2014. Written and produced by Ben Babbitt and mastered by Theo Karon. An old version was produced, recorded, and mixed by Ben Babbitt. This old version featured the in-game version of "Too Late to Love You" which included the in-game vocal take and a short ambient section after the first chorus (the same found in-game when taking time to decide on a lyrical option), and is 6:14 in length. The newer master by Theo Karon features a different vocal take and is the same one found on Junebug's album of the same name.
"Too Late To Love You" features lyrics by Jake Elliott. "What Would You Give" features vocals by Emily Cross, with Bob Buckstaff on upright bass.

A recording of "This World Is Not My Home" performed by The Bedquilt Ramblers was released in the August 2011 [[newsletter]] and is available to listen to [http[:File://cardboardcomputer.com/media/this_worldThis World is Not My Home by The Bedquilt Ramblers.mp3 |here] ([https://soundcloud.com/kentucky-route-zero-music/ben-babbitt-this-world-is-not mirror]). This song was eventually re-recorded in a more somber tone for [[Act IV]] of the game. The game's [https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=0pvkCYNhf7M Kickstarter trailer] features a version of this song sung by [[wikipedia:Bill Monroe|Bill Monroe]].
